How It Works
The Trady chat system is built using Supabase Realtime (or socket.io), integrated directly into the token page.
Whenever a user clicks on a token to view its data or perform a swap, they also gain access to that token’s live chatroom. No additional login is required. The chat is tied to the user’s in-browser Trady wallet.
Here’s what happens:
You open a token
The token's chart, swap interface, and chat appear side-by-side
You can send and receive messages instantly
Messages are timestamped and tagged by wallet (partial ID shown)
Whale alerts, rug flags, and system messages are injected into the feed
You can react to messages using emojis or flags
Everything is self-contained. You never need to switch tabs or open Discord — the social layer is native.
